At the initial stages after the inception of the University of Kalyani in the year 1961 the Central Library had no building of its own. The library housed initially in the B.T. College building. It was thereafter shifted to a hostel building and from there to the sociology building and lastly to the administrative building. Thereafter it has been shifted to its own two-storied building in July, 1979. In a lively University campus, the Central Library serves as the hive of academic activities for students, scholars, staffs and faculty members in the pursuit of excellence in their respective area of studies.

With more than One and half Lakhs volumes of books, about 110 printed current journals and periodicals and back volumes of numerous important journals, the library is reasonably good. Automation facilities, Reprographic facilities, Reference Service, Digital Information Services are rendered to the attractive user community.

The idea of automation of Central Library of the University of Kalyani was first initiated under the auspices of INFLIBNET programme. The Central Library procured CDS/ISIS software package developed by UNESCO and later on 35000 books, 300 bound journals and 1000 theses were incorporated. Central Library has already procured SOUL software developed by INFLIBNET, UGC and automation of house-keeping work is going on very fast.
